Chicken alla Diavola

A classic Italian recipe for chicken 'alla diavola' – flattened, spiced, and cooked under a weight for a crispy skin and juicy meat. Served with a spicy tomato salad.

Ingredients
14 items- 1/2 kgPollo InteroOr cockerel, about 500 g
- 1 pcsLemonUse both zest and juice
- 2 pcsBay Leaves
- 3 pcsGarlicCloves
- 1 pcsLeekCut into large chunks
- Salsa WorcesterTo taste
- Tabasco AffumicatoFor the tomato salad; to taste
- Sweet PaprikaSweet paprika
- FlourOr cornstarch (maizena) or potato starch (fecola)
- Chili PepperChili pepper, to taste
- 5 pcsCherry TomatoesCherry tomatoes
- Extra Virgin Olive OilExtra virgin olive oil, to taste
- SaltTo taste
- Black PepperBlack pepper, to taste
Method
- Clean the chicken: remove any internal bags and cut along the breast to open it like a book. Remove the wing tips (save for broth).
- Place the chicken between two sheets of plastic wrap and flatten with a meat mallet until even thickness (about 1.5 cm).
- Season the skin side with black pepper, sweet paprika, and Worcestershire sauce. Turn and season the inside with lemon juice, black pepper, sweet paprika, and chili pepper. Let marinate for 5 minutes.
- Heat olive oil in a large pan over high heat. Add strips of lemon zest (yellow part only). When hot, place the chicken skin side down.
- Immediately place a smaller pot filled with hot water on top of the chicken to press it down. Cook over medium-low heat for 2 minutes.
- Add the garlic cloves and bay leaves around the chicken, replace the weight, and cook for another 2 minutes.
- Remove the weight, turn the chicken over, season with salt, add the leek cut into large chunks. Replace the weight and cook for 10 minutes over low heat.
- Turn the chicken skin side up again, replace the weight, and cook for another 3-4 minutes per side until fully cooked (internal temperature 74°C).
- While the chicken cooks, prepare the salad: in a bowl, combine cherry tomatoes, a dash of smoked Tabasco, salt, and olive oil. Set aside.
- When the chicken is done, remove it to a plate. To the same pan, sprinkle flour (or cornstarch/potato starch) and stir into the cooking juices. Add a splash of hot water (the same used for the weight) and stir until a creamy sauce forms.
- Serve the chicken on a plate, pour the sauce over, and accompany with the tomato salad.
